#include <sys/cdefs.h>
__KERNEL_RCSID(0, "$NetBSD: adm5120_obio.c,v 1.6 2021/08/07 16:18:58 thorpej Exp $");

#include <sys/param.h>
#include <sys/systm.h>
#include <sys/device.h>

#include <sys/bus.h>

#include <mips/cache.h>
#include <mips/cpuregs.h>

#include <mips/adm5120/include/adm5120reg.h>
#include <mips/adm5120/include/adm5120var.h>
#include <mips/adm5120/include/adm5120_mainbusvar.h>
#include <mips/adm5120/include/adm5120_obiovar.h>

#include "locators.h"

#ifdef OBIO_DEBUG
int obio_debug = 1;
#define OBIO_DPRINTF(__fmt, ...)                \
do {                                            \
       if (obio_debug)                 \
               printf((__fmt), __VA_ARGS__);   \
} while (/*CONSTCOND*/0)
#else /* !OBIO_DEBUG */
#define OBIO_DPRINTF(__fmt, ...)        do { } while (/*CONSTCOND*/0)
#endif /* OBIO_DEBUG */

static int      obio_match(device_t, cfdata_t, void *);
static void     obio_attach(device_t, device_t, void *);
static int      obio_submatch(device_t, cfdata_t, const int *, void *);
static int      obio_print(void *, const char *);

CFATTACH_DECL_NEW(obio, 0, obio_match, obio_attach, NULL, NULL);

/* There can be only one. */
int     obio_found;

struct obiodev {
       const char      *od_name;
       bus_addr_t      od_addr;
       int             od_irq;
       uint32_t        od_gpio_mask;
};

const struct obiodev obiodevs[] = {
       {"uart",        ADM5120_BASE_UART0,     1, 0x0},
       {"uart",        ADM5120_BASE_UART1,     2, 0x0},
       {"admsw",       ADM5120_BASE_SWITCH,    9, 0x0},
       {"ahci",        ADM5120_BASE_USB,       3, 0x0},
       {"admflash",    ADM5120_BASE_SRAM0,     0, 0x0},
       {NULL,          0,                      0, 0x0},
};

static int
obio_match(device_t parent, cfdata_t match, void *aux)
{
       return !obio_found;
}

static void
obio_attach_args_create(struct obio_attach_args *oa, const struct obiodev *od,
   void *gpio, bus_dma_tag_t dmat, bus_space_tag_t st)
{
       oa->oba_name = od->od_name;
       oa->oba_addr = od->od_addr;
       oa->oba_irq = od->od_irq;
       oa->oba_dt = dmat;
       oa->oba_st = st;
       oa->oba_gpio = gpio;
       oa->oba_gpio_mask = od->od_gpio_mask;
}

static void
obio_attach(device_t parent, device_t self, void *aux)
{
       struct mainbus_attach_args *ma = (struct mainbus_attach_args *)aux;
       struct obio_attach_args oa;
       const struct obiodev *od;

       obio_found = 1;
       printf("\n");

       OBIO_DPRINTF("%s: %d\n", __func__, __LINE__);

       OBIO_DPRINTF("%s: %d\n", __func__, __LINE__);
       for (od = obiodevs; od->od_name != NULL; od++) {
               OBIO_DPRINTF("%s: %d\n", __func__, __LINE__);
               obio_attach_args_create(&oa, od, ma->ma_gpio, ma->ma_dmat,
                   ma->ma_obiot);
               OBIO_DPRINTF("%s: %d\n", __func__, __LINE__);
               config_found(self, &oa, obio_print,
                   CFARGS(.submatch = obio_submatch,
                          .iattr = "obio"));
       }
       OBIO_DPRINTF("%s: %d\n", __func__, __LINE__);
}

static int
obio_submatch(device_t parent, cfdata_t cf, const int *ldesc, void *aux)
{
       struct obio_attach_args *oa = aux;

       if (cf->cf_loc[OBIOCF_ADDR] != OBIOCF_ADDR_DEFAULT &&
           cf->cf_loc[OBIOCF_ADDR] != oa->oba_addr)
               return 0;

       return config_match(parent, cf, aux);
}

static int
obio_print(void *aux, const char *pnp)
{
       struct obio_attach_args *oa = aux;

       if (pnp != NULL)
               aprint_normal("%s at %s", oa->oba_name, pnp);
       if (oa->oba_addr != OBIOCF_ADDR_DEFAULT)
               aprint_normal(" addr 0x%"PRIxBUSADDR, oa->oba_addr);
       if (oa->oba_gpio_mask != OBIOCF_GPIO_MASK_DEFAULT)
               aprint_normal(" gpio_mask 0x%02x", oa->oba_gpio_mask);

       return UNCONF;
}
